Mention the Roaring Twenties, and all the usual icons come to mind: flappers, prohibition, and jazz. But, the humor of the 1920s has been mostly overlooked. In this book, you will find a sample of 1920s humor in the form of The Melting Pot, a newspaper column from that era.
Carefully restored from many rolls of a slowly deteriorating microfilm, The Melting Pot has been preserved as a small piece of a time long gone in years, but still relevant in its effects upon the thoughts, values and customs of our own modern-day world. Inside this book, in a fascinating blend of history and humor, The Melting Pot will educate and entertain you.
